The editorial take

Wine on Water is a wine-first bar and shop with over 150 selections, emphasizing small-production, sustainable, and organic producers. The cocktail list is compact but competent, with four $16 drinks built on quality spirits. Weekly events like Thursday wine nights and Monday Wine Divvy anchor a convivial, education-minded program. A rotating by-the-glass list and reasonable bottle prices make it an accessible neighborhood stop.

What should I order?
Start with the Wine on Whiskey Sour, which layers red wine over Buffalo Trace. For something brighter, the Mezcal Margarita with Los Vecinos and Tajin. Wine drinkers should explore the rotating by-the-glass list, perhaps the Gruner Veltliner or the Les Lunes rosé. Bottles range from $56 to $72, offering good value for sustainable picks.
Who will enjoy this place?
Wine enthusiasts seeking small-production and sustainable labels will find much to like, as will beginners drawn to the educational tastings and knowledgeable staff. The compact cocktail list appeals to those who prefer a few well-made classics over a long menu. The relaxed, romantic patio suits couples and small groups.
When should I go?
Thursday wine nights and Monday Wine Divvy are weekly opportunities to taste and mingle. Evenings on the outdoor patio are particularly pleasant, per guest remarks. The shop setting also invites casual afternoon browsing.
What should I expect to spend?
Cocktails are $16 each. Wine by the glass runs $14 to $17; bottles $56 to $72. This pricing is moderate for a wine bar, with bottle prices particularly approachable given the focus on quality producers.
What makes the beverage program distinctive?
A dual bar-and-shop format with a wine list tilted toward small-production, sustainable, and organic wineries. The rotating by-the-glass list and weekly events create a community feel. Food can be ordered from adjacent Small Giant, sharing the same owner, extending the experience. Over 150 selections provide depth uncommon in a neighborhood spot.

Cocktails

Inebrious Cocktails score: 86 out of 100

A concise list of four cocktails, each $16, using quality spirits like Buffalo Trace and Los Vecinos mezcal. Offerings span a whiskey sour variant, a mezcal margarita, a coffee-forward Carajillo, and a rosemary old fashioned.

Menu strengths

  • Classic and creative options with quality spirits; Uniform pricing at $16 simplifies ordering

Standout selections

  • Wine on Whiskey Sour: Buffalo Trace, lemon, red wine, optional egg white
  • Carajillo: Licor 43, cold brew, Wheatley Vodka, Giffard Cafe du Honduras

Pricing: $16 each

Wine

Inebrious Wine score: 90 out of 100

Over 150 selections focusing on small-production, sustainable, and organic wineries. Includes sparkling rosé, rosé, whites, reds, and Madeira, with a rotating by-the-glass list and weekly tasting events.

Menu strengths

  • Extensive selection with a focus on small-production and sustainable wines

Standout selections

  • Sparkling Rosé De Grenelle: Cabernet Franc, Loire, $15/60
  • Light White Gruner Veltliner: Glatzer, Austria, $14/56
  • Medium Earthy Red Tibaldi Barbera d'Alba: Piedmont, Italy, $15/68

Pricing: Glasses $14-$17; bottles $56-$72

How it sits with the food

Food can be ordered from adjacent Small Giant, which shares the same owner, allowing for pairing with the wine list. The wine program's range—from light whites to earthy reds—offers flexibility for various dishes. Guests have noted this pairing option as a plus.
